How do I control ants?

There are many new options for ant control. Identification is the key to selecting a control method and applying it correctly. Bring several of the ants to your local Extension office and request identification and control recommendations. Many people try to control ants by spraying the ones they see. This approach usually fails, because the ants that are seen are only a small portion of the colony. Typically, there will be thousands of additional ants, including one or more egg-laying queens hidden somewhere in a nest. Eliminating queens and other colony members within nests is often the key to effective ant control.
